linux自學

linux文件基本屬性linux

  爲何:爲了保護系統的安全性,linux引入訪問文件權限安全

  什麼樣:d  rwx  r-x  r-x,從左向右用0-9這些表示(r爲度,w爲寫,x爲執行)spa

  • 0表示文件類型
  • 1~3表示文件全部者擁有的權限
  • 4~6表示全部者同組擁有的權限
  • 7~9表示其餘用戶擁有的權限
  • d爲目錄
  • -是文件
  • l是連接
  • b裝置文件中可供儲存的接口設備(可隨機存取裝置)
  • c裝置文件裏面的串行端口設備(一次性存取裝置)

更改文件屬性遞歸

1.chgrp:更改文件屬組接口

  chgrp [-R] 屬組名 文件名  (-R表示遞歸該目錄下的全部文件)權限

2.chown:更改文件屬主,也可同時更改文件屬組端口

  chown [-R] 屬主名 文件名文件

  chown [-R] 屬主名:屬組名 文件名安全性

  例如:數字

    chown localhost xxx.log(文件的全部者改成localhost用戶)

    chrown root:root xxx.log(將xxx.log的擁有者改成root)

3.chmod更改文件的9個屬性

  按照數字(r4,w2,x1,相加獲得權限)

    chmod [-R] 7 文件或者目錄

  按照字母

    chmod u=rwx,g=rx,o=r 文件名

相關文章
相關標籤/搜索